FCT Minister Reaffirms Commitment To Strengthen Health Services

Minister of State for the Federal Capital Territory (FCT), Dr Mariya Mahmoud has reaffirmed the administration’s commitment to improving healthcare delivery.

Mahmoud said this would be achieved through investments in infrastructure, workforce development, and stronger collaboration among medical professionals.

The minister stated this in her keynote address at the maiden summit of the Dental Technologists Registration Board of Nigeria (DTRBN), in Abuja.

She emphasised the critical role of dental technologists in multidisciplinary healthcare teams, particularly as global awareness of oral health and advancements in prosthetics continue to rise.

“The dental technology profession is evolving rapidly, and we must adapt to the transformative impact of digitisation and artificial intelligence.

“I urge practitioners to embrace innovation, prioritise standardised training, and strive for global competitiveness to meet modern healthcare demands,” she said.

The minister also advocated for increased research and local production of dental materials to reduce reliance on imports.

“We must cultivate a culture of research and domestic manufacturing to enhance self-sufficiency and improve service delivery,” she added.

Charging participants to engage in meaningful deliberations, Mahmoud expressed optimism that the summit would produce actionable recommendations to shape national policy and elevate professional standards.

She expressed the readiness of the FCT Administration towards supporting initiatives that enhance healthcare, saying “we take pride in the achievements of dental technologists.”

Earlier, the Registrar of the Dental Technologists Registration Board of Nigeria, Malam Idris Bappah, described the summit as a pivotal platform for addressing challenges in the profession.

“This summit is a critical opportunity for us to collectively identify obstacles and propose innovative solutions that will strengthen the human factor within our profession,” Bappah stated.
